Common Side effects of Yactum 500mg/250mg Injection:

  • Increased white blood cell count (eosinophils)
  • Decreased white blood cell count (lymphocytes)
  • Low blood platelets
  • Rash
  • Diarrhea
  • Increased liver enzymes
  • Injection site reactions (pain, swelling, redness)

How Yactum 500mg/250mg Injection works:

Ceftriaxone/Sulbactam 500mg/250mg Injection (Yactum) combines the antibiotic Ceftriaxone with the beta-lactamase inhibitor Sulbactam. Ceftriaxone's mechanism involves disrupting bacterial cell wall synthesis, vital for bacterial viability. Sulbactam counteracts bacterial resistance mechanisms, thereby boosting Ceftriaxone's effectiveness.

FAQs on Yactum 500mg/250mg Injection

Yactum 500mg/250mg Injection may cause allergic reactions and is contraindicated in patients allergic to cephalosporin antibiotics. Seek immediate medical attention for any allergic symptoms such as hives, breathing difficulties, or swelling of the face, lips, tongue, or throat.
Diarrhea is a possible side effect of Yactum 500mg/250mg Injection. This antibiotic, while eliminating harmful bacteria, can also disrupt beneficial gut bacteria, leading to diarrhea. Consult your doctor if you experience severe diarrhea.
Yactum 500mg/250mg Injection typically begins working quickly, though complete bacterial eradication and symptom relief may take several days.
Contact your doctor if your symptoms worsen during treatment or haven't improved after completing the prescribed course.
Continue taking Yactum 500mg/250mg Injection as prescribed, completing the entire course. Even if you feel better, stopping early may not fully eliminate the infection.
